Designed for engineers and designers, Smd Fuse (Smd,6.1X2.7Mm) helps visualize, prototype, and integrate into mechanical systems.
The CAD model comprises 169 faces, 385 edges, and 222 vertices. It consists of 14 solids, with surface types including 67 planar, 56 cylindrical, 0 conical, 0 spherical, 8 toroidal, and 38 other surfaces. Its orientations include 64 along the X-axis, 55 along the Y-axis, 50 along the Z-axis, and 0 with various orientations. The model dimensions are approximately 6.10 mm wide, 2.69 mm high, and 2.69 mm deep. Volumetric data includes a maximum volume of 50.08 mm³, minimum volume of 0.00 mm³, and average volume of 6.87 mm³, with a total volume of 96.22 mm³.
